> I feel that the original proposal, as specified elsewhere, violates the
> principle of least surprise for existing users starting new projects (not
> using convert-ly) with the new LilyPond.
I'm not sure I understand why that's true… As I understand the proposal,
\relative { c''' d e f }
would come out as a rising step-wise scale, starting on c''' — which is not in
the least surprising to me.
Please explain how it's surprising, or how I am perhaps misunderstanding the
original proposal.
